Innovative Designs for Modern Sleeping Spaces

Elevated Aesthetics with Platform King Beds

Platform king beds have transcended simple furniture to become statements of modern design. The clean lines and minimalist aesthetic of these beds lend themselves perfectly to a variety of interior styles. From sleek, industrial lofts to cozy, Scandinavian-inspired bedrooms, a platform king bed can anchor the space while maintaining a sense of openness and calm. Designers are now pushing the boundaries of traditional platform bed design, exploring materials like reclaimed wood, polished concrete, and even woven rattan to create unique and eye-catching pieces.

Maximizing Space with Integrated Storage

The modern bedroom often serves multiple purposes, and space is a valuable commodity. Platform king beds are meeting this demand with clever integrated storage solutions. Drawers seamlessly built into the base provide ample room for linens, clothing, or seasonal items, eliminating the need for bulky dressers and maximizing floor space. Some designs even feature hidden compartments and lift-up platforms, revealing even more storage capacity, making these beds ideal for smaller apartments or homes where every inch counts. This integration of form and function underscores the modern focus on practicality without sacrificing style.

Platform King Beds: Embracing Low-Profile Living

The low-profile design of platform king beds is a key characteristic, contributing to a feeling of spaciousness and airiness in the bedroom. This ground-hugging aesthetic aligns with modern design principles that emphasize simplicity and uncluttered environments. By eliminating the traditional box spring, platform king beds create a streamlined silhouette that effortlessly blends into the overall decor, promoting a sense of tranquility and ease. Furthermore, the lower height often makes the bed more accessible, especially for individuals with mobility issues, and contributes to a calming visual effect, making the room feel less overwhelming.

Material Matters: A Focus on Sustainability and Luxury

The choice of materials in platform king beds reflects the growing consumer awareness of sustainability and desire for lasting luxury. Manufacturers are increasingly turning to ethically sourced woods, recycled materials, and eco-friendly finishes. Solid hardwoods, such as oak, walnut, and maple, are popular choices for their durability and timeless appeal. Beyond sustainable options, luxury materials like leather and velvet are also making their way into platform king bed designs, offering a sumptuous feel and adding an element of sophistication to the sleeping space. The emphasis is on creating a bed that not only looks good but also aligns with values of environmental responsibility and quality craftsmanship.

Benefits of Platform King Beds for Ultimate Support

Enhanced Spinal Alignment

Platform king beds, with their typically firm and even surfaces, can promote better spinal alignment during sleep. This is because the mattress receives consistent support across its entire area, preventing sagging and uneven distribution of weight that can lead to back pain. The solid base reduces pressure points and encourages a more neutral spine position.

Superior Weight Distribution

Unlike traditional box spring setups, platform king beds excel in distributing weight evenly. This is beneficial for couples as it minimizes motion transfer, meaning less disturbance from a partner's movements during the night. The flat, stable surface ensures that both sides of the mattress maintain a consistent level of firmness and support.

Increased Mattress Longevity

The consistent support provided by a platform king bed can extend the life of your mattress. Because the mattress is evenly supported and doesn't experience the dips and sags associated with weaker foundations, it is less prone to premature wear and tear. This makes platform king beds a cost-effective long-term investment.

Versatile Style Options

Platform king beds come in a wide array of designs and materials, making them a versatile choice for various interior aesthetics. From sleek modern styles to rustic farmhouse looks, there is a platform king bed to complement any bedroom décor. The low profile design also allows for a more open and spacious feel in the room.

Elimination of the Need for a Box Spring

Platform king beds eliminate the need for a bulky box spring. This reduces the overall height of the bed and creates a more contemporary and streamlined appearance. The absence of a box spring also contributes to lower costs, as one less item is needed to complete your bed setup.

Choosing the Right Platform Bed Frame for Your Bedroom

Understanding Platform King Beds

Platform king beds offer a sleek and modern alternative to traditional bed frames. They eliminate the need for a box spring, providing a solid and supportive base for your mattress. This design not only contributes to a minimalist aesthetic but also often creates a lower profile bed, which can be particularly appealing in contemporary spaces. The "platform" itself can be constructed from various materials, each offering different benefits in terms of style, durability, and price.

Material Choices for Platform King Beds

When selecting platform king beds, the material is a crucial factor. Popular options include:

  • Wood: Offers a classic and warm feel. Wood platform beds come in a variety of finishes and styles, from light oak to dark mahogany, making it easy to match existing bedroom furniture. However, solid wood options can be pricier.
  • Metal: Provides a more industrial or contemporary look. Metal platform beds are generally lightweight, durable, and often less expensive than wood alternatives. They can be minimalist in design or feature more intricate detailing.
  • Upholstered: Feature a fabric covering, adding a touch of luxury and softness. Upholstered platform beds can range from basic designs to ornate styles with tufting and nailhead trim, allowing for customization of colors and patterns.

Style and Design Considerations

The design of your platform king bed should complement the overall style of your bedroom. Consider the following:

  • Minimalist: Clean lines and simple designs characterize minimalist platform beds, often focusing on functionality and a clutter-free aesthetic.
  • Modern: Incorporates contemporary materials, unique shapes, and bold designs. Often features a low profile and sleek look.
  • Traditional: Includes classic design elements such as carved wood, detailed headboards, and rich finishes.
  • Rustic: Emphasizes natural materials, such as unfinished wood, and features a more relaxed and casual design.
  • Industrial: Uses metal or reclaimed wood, often featuring exposed hardware and a more urban feel.

Features to Look for

Beyond style and material, several features can enhance the functionality and comfort of your platform king beds:

  • Storage: Some platform beds come with built-in drawers or storage compartments, a great option for optimizing space, especially in smaller bedrooms.
  • Headboard: The presence and style of a headboard significantly impacts the bed's look. Some are simple and integrated, while others are elaborate and detached.
  • Slat Design: Ensure the slats are sturdy and spaced appropriately to support your mattress effectively and provide adequate airflow.
  • Height: The height of the platform impacts the overall look and accessibility of the bed. Low-profile beds create a modern feel, while higher platforms offer more storage space.

Measuring Your Space and Mattress

Before purchasing platform king beds, it's critical to accurately measure your bedroom to ensure the bed will fit comfortably. Also, confirm the dimensions of your existing mattress or plan accordingly if buying a new one. Platform beds are designed to fit standard mattress sizes, but verifying the specifications is key. Consider the additional space needed for nightstands and other bedroom furniture.
